Setup Checklist for Growing Gelato 33 Seeds Gelato 33 thrives when you give it a stable environment. This strain is moderately easy to grow, responds well to training, and rewards care with frosty, flavorful buds.
🏕️ Indoor Setup Tent: 2×2 ft or larger Lighting: LED (300–600W range) Ventilation: Inline fan + carbon filter Air Circulation: Clip-on oscillating fan Humidity Control: Hygrometer + humidifier/dehumidifier Pots: 3–5 gallon fabric pots Medium: Soil or coco/perlite mix Nutrients: Standard veg + bloom feed, Cal-Mag, optional terp boosters Water: pH 6.2–6.6 🌞 Outdoor Notes Climate: Warm, sunny, Mediterranean-like Location: Nutrient-rich soil with good drainage Harvest: End of September before autumn rains Protection: Stakes for heavy buds + pest deterrents (netting/neem) Germination: Starting Your Gelato 33 Grow Use the damp paper towel method for consistency.
Steps :
Place seeds between two damp paper towels. Sandwich between paper plates for darkness and breathability. Store at 70–75°F, checking daily. When the taproot reaches ~½ inch, transplant into soil root-tip down. ⚠️ Avoid sealing in bags or exposing sprouting seeds to direct light.
Week 1: Seedling Stage ✅ What to Expect
Height: 1–2 in Growth: Cotyledons + first true leaves Color: Bright green Roots: Anchoring 🧪 Environment Targets
Light: 18–24 hrs, low intensity (~24–30 in away) Humidity: 65–70% Temp: 72–77°F Water: Small, light circle around stem Nutrients: None yet (except light Cal-Mag in coco) 👩🌾 Tips
Don’t overwater. Gentle airflow helps stem strength. Lower lights slightly if seedlings stretch. Week 2: Early Veg + Optional LST ✅ What to Expect
Height: 2–4 in Growth: 3–5 finger leaves Structure: Tight internodes Stems: Thicker, sturdier 🌡️ Environment Targets
Light: 18 hrs/day, moderate intensity (~300 PPFD) Humidity: 60–65% Temp: 73–78°F Nutrients: Start light veg feed (¼ strength) 🌱 Optional LST
Bend main stem gently and tie to pot edge Spread canopy for even light coverage Week 4: Pre-Flower & Final Veg Training ✅ What to Expect
Height: 8–12 in Growth: Bushy, pre-flowers appear Aroma: Hints of vanilla and citrus 🌡️ Environment Targets
Light: 18/6, ~500 PPFD Humidity: 50–55% Temp: 73–78°F Nutrients: Full-strength veg feed 🌱 Final Training
Adjust LST or SCROG net Defoliate lightly for airflow Prep for 12/12 switch next week Week 5: Flower Begins ✅ What to Expect
Height: 12–18 in, stretch begins Growth: Pistils at nodes Smell: Vanilla-citrus hints get stronger 🌡️ Environment Targets
Light: Flip to 12/12 Humidity: 45–50% Temp: 72–78°F Nutrients: Bloom feed (high P & K, lower N) 🌱 Tips

Height: 18–24 in Buds: Sites forming on each cola Trichomes: Early sparkle visible Smell: Sweet, creamy citrus aroma 🌡️ Environment Targets
Light: 12/12 (~600 PPFD) Humidity: 45% Temp: 70–77°F Nutrients: Full bloom feed + Cal-Mag 🌱 Tips
Avoid heavy defoliation Support side branches early Week 7: Bud Fattening & Aroma Surge 🌸🔥 ✅ What to Expect
Height: 24–28 in Buds: Stacking, thickening Trichomes: Visible frost Smell: Loud vanilla, lemon, and spice 🌡️ Environment Targets
Light: 12/12, increase to ~700 PPFD Humidity: 40–45% Temp: 68–75°F Nutrients: Bloom nutes + optional terp booster 🌱 Tips
Stake heavy branches Watch for nutrient tip burn Week 8: Peak Flower & Ripening Begins ✅ What to Expect
Height: 30–34 in Buds: Dense, sticky, stacking Pistils: Turning orange Trichomes: Clouding over 🌡️ Environment Targets
Light: 12/12, ~700–800 PPFD Humidity: 40% Temp: 67–73°F Nutrients: Reduce nitrogen, boost PK 🌱 Tips
Monitor trichomes with loupe Don’t rush, flavor peaks late Week 9: Final Flush & Ripeness Check ✅ What to Expect
Buds: Dense, frosty, sticky Trichomes: Mostly cloudy, some amber Pistils: 60–80% dark Smell: Sweet, creamy, pungent 🌡️ Environment Targets
Light: Maintain 12/12 Humidity: 35–40% Temp: 65–70°F Water: Plain pH’d water, flush 5–7 days 🌱 Tips
Harvest at cloudy/amber mix for best effect Cooler temps boost color and terps Harvest & Curing Chop at end of September outdoors or week 9 indoors. Dry at 60°F / 55% RH for 10–14 days. Cure in glass jars, burping daily for first week. After 3–4 weeks, buds hit peak creamy-citrus flavor.
